LWHS Renaissance Fair Helps the Students Shine

KINGMAN – Fairies, sword fights, Shakespeare and baked treats.

Lee Williams High School stagecraft students, with the leadership of their teacher, Paula Pickett, put on an inaugural ‘Lee Ol Renaissance Faire’ Friday.

More than 50 students, teachers, parents and other spectators set up camp in the school’s grassy common area adjacent to the cafeteria to show off months of building sets and rehearsing acts as part of a fundraiser for the drama and stagecraft classes.

7th Annual Monsoon Madness 5K

KINGMAN – The 7th Annual Monsoon Madness 5K run will be held Saturday, Sept. 7. The run is a fundraiser for the Lee Williams and Kingman High Schools’ cross-country programs. Monies raised from the event will go toward entry fees, uniforms, equipment, and transportation costs. The race starts at White Cliffs Middle School at 7 a.m. Call 970-314-5689 to register or for more information.
